Charles Schwab Corporation, founded in 1971 by Charles R. Schwab and headquartered in Westlake, Texas, is a leading financial services firm that revolutionized retail investing by offering low-cost brokerage services. Initially disrupting the industry with discount commissions, it has grown into a powerhouse providing a wide array of services, including trading platforms, robo-advisors, retirement accounts, and banking products, managing hundreds of billions in client assets. Known for its user-friendly technology and customer-centric approach, Schwab caters to individual investors, financial advisors, and institutions, notably expanding through its 2020 acquisition of TD Ameritrade. With a mission to democratize investing, Charles Schwab remains a dominant force in the shift toward accessible, self-directed wealth management.

Charles Schwab's Q2 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2015, Charles Schwab held 3,232 positions worth $72.4B, up 1.8% from $71.1B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 14% of the portfolio.

Charles Schwab's Q2 2015 filing shows 150 new, 2,258 increased, 427 reduced and 137 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Citizens Financial Group: 394,487 shares worth $10.8M. The largest sale was Merck, an estimated $85.8M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 15% of assets, up from 15%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Technology.
